Ordinals
beta
Address bc1qtpua4jew4rw4qgvgjezvl0n5kkch3qgx2egdeq
sat balance
2266992
runes balances
outputs
ec0890a9c2079fdae3cbec8cd329bdfc9752cea6faa4e5d429684191b2c7570a:1